Q: What do I do if the Flagpole rollout service loses its admin session during an incident?

A: Flagpole admin sessions expire after 30 minutes of inactivity. If the primary on-call account is locked out, use the break-glass recovery flow from the internal console. It will prompt for the standby recovery credential before re-enabling flag writes. For reference, the current recovery passphrase is:

vault phrase of tajef-tafog = istox-sorax-zorox-casok-holox-kelix-weneth-drueth-casion

- [ ] Step 7: Archive cold storage buckets (Glacierline tier). Confirm both ceremony witnesses are present, verify bucket manifests match the Oxbow ledger, then seal the archive key shares. Plugin authors may observe but not handle shares. Once sealed, the archive index itself is encrypted and can only be reopened with the passphrase below.

vault phrase of badup-hahig = tamael-aldael-kelmir-istael-fenok-istwyn-tamius-jorath-oliion

Changed defaults in Splitfork, our assignment service. Bucketing now uses sticky hashing per account instead of per session, and the holdout slice grew from 2% to 5%. Callers relying on session-level reassignment must opt in explicitly. Review the diff against the new baseline; the updated default configuration is listed below.

config for tagep-kajof:
[casir]
port = 6379
region = south-1
host = casir.paliqdyn.example
team = tamax
timeout_ms = 250
retries = 2

## Tuning

Quotacrest enforces per-tenant rate limits at the gateway. Before each release, confirm the defaults below match the approved capacity plan; raising any of them without load-testing risks saturating the shared token store. Changes must land in config, never in code. The shipped defaults are as follows.

constants for tageg-kagag:
QUOTAS = {
    "kelax": 495,
    "istath": 366,
    "tammir": 108,
    "novdor": 730,
    "casax": 816,
    "quenael": 874,
    "pelius": 403,
}